Pasta and Beans

A comforting one-pot dish blending tender cannellini beans, savory ground beef, and pasta in a fragrant tomato-and-herb broth, perfect for cooler evenings.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 45 minutes
Course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ine Italian
Servings 6 servings
Calories 350 kcal

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ients

  • 1 lb ground beef Use halal-certified beef for a fully halal-friendly meal.
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 2 medium carrots, diced
  • 2 stalks celery, diced
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ced Don’t let the garlic burn.
  • 1 can (15 oz) cannellini beans, drained and rinsed Swappable with great northern or navy beans.
  • 1 can (14.5 oz) diced tomatoes
  • 4 cups beef broth Use halal-certified broth if needed.
  • 1 cup small pasta (like ditalini) Small pasta ensures even distribution.
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1 teaspoon dried basil
  • to taste Salt and pepper
  • as needed tablespoon Olive oil for sautéing

Instructions
 

Preparation

  • In a large pot,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add the ground beef and cook until browned. Drain excess fat.
  • Add the diced onions, carrots, and celery. Cook until the vegetables are softened, about 5–7 minutes.
  • Stir in the minced garlic and cook for an additional minute.
  • Add the diced tomatoes, cannellini beans, beef broth, oregano, basil, salt, and pepper. Bring to a boil.
  • Stir in the pasta and reduce heat to a simmer. Cook until the pasta is tender, about 10–12 minutes.
  •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ary. Serve hot with crusty bread.

Notes

For a thicker stew, mash some beans. Consider variations like vegetarian swaps, using gluten-free pasta, or adding greens toward the end of cooking.
